Impacts of Polygamous Marriage on Women's Land Rights in Ethiopia - Its Impacts on Women's Rural Land Rights in Sidama Zone,Southern Nations, Nationalities and Peoples Regional State

This book provides the impacts of polygamous marriage on women s rural land holding and use rights. Combinations of qualitative and quantitative research approaches were employed to collect the required data and information for the study. The empirical results showed that polygamous marriages have negative impacts on women s rural land holding and use rights. In country as like Ethiopia whose economy is based on agriculture, land holding and use rights are the major determinants of household s livelihoods and social status. This book analyzed protection of women s rural land rights in international instruments and national legislation in light of the practice in the study area. The analysis mainly helps all government and non governmental organizations who work for empowering women s capacity in a sustainable manner to give due attention for the impacts of polygamous marriage.
